Fourth Court of Appeals San Antonio, Texas February 2, 2023 No. 04-23-00076-CR Paul MENA, Appellant v. The STATE of Texas, Appellee From the 175th Judicial District Court, Bexar County, Texas Trial Court No. 2022CR4184 Honorable Catherine Torres-Stahl, Judge Presiding
ORDER The trial court imposed or suspended sentence on December 6, 2022. Because appellant did not file a motion for new trial, his notice of appeal was due on January 5, 2023. Appellant filed his notice of appeal on January 20, 2023, and also filed a timely motion for extension of time to file his notice of appeal. TEX. R. APP. P. 26.3. We GRANT appellant’s motion for extension of time to file his notice of appeal and retain this appeal on the docket of this court.
